Creating Collective Booking Calendars in Stack

Collective Booking Calendars in Stack allow multiple team members to collaborate on appointments seamlessly. This guide will walk you through setting up and managing these calendars effectively.

Table of Contents

Setting Up a Collective Booking Calendar

  1. Access Calendar Settings

    • Navigate to Calendars and select Calendar Settings.
  2. Create a New Calendar

    • Click on Create Calendar.
    • Choose Collective Booking.
  3. Enter Calendar Details

    • Calendar Name: Provide a name for your calendar.
    • Select Team Members: Choose at least two team members to participate in this calendar.
    • Custom URL: Set a unique URL for easy access.
    • Meeting Location: Although optional, it is recommended to specify a meeting location. If left blank, the primary owner's custom meeting location will be used by default.
  4. Finalize Creation

    • Click Confirm to create your Collective Calendar.
  5. Customize Calendar Settings

    • For advanced customization, click on Go to advanced settings during creation, or edit the calendar later by selecting Edit Calendar.

Managing Calendar Owners

Setting the Primary Owner

The primary owner is the team member who leads the appointment. They are also the appointment owner, and if contact assignment is enabled, contacts will be assigned to them.

  • By default, the first team member added becomes the primary owner.
  • The primary owner cannot be removed from the calendar.

Changing the Primary Owner

  1. Go to Advanced Settings or Edit Calendar.
  2. Navigate to Meeting Details.
  3. Click Make owner next to the desired team member's name.
  4. The new primary owner will be indicated with an "Owner" label.

Note: Ensure the primary owner is not the team member you wish to remove from the calendar.

Notification System

  • Only the assigned user will receive email notifications.
  • All team members will receive calendar invite notifications through their integrated third-party calendars (Google, Outlook, iCloud).

Handling Payments

If payments are enabled for the Collective Booking Calendar, users must complete payment before their appointment is confirmed. This ensures a smooth booking process and secures the appointment slot.
